Description

Discusses hopes for a personal meeting with the Indians soon, as well as the threat of unscrupulous individuals encroaching on Indian land; despite such incidents, urges the Indians to remain at peace. Discusses relations with the Canadians, and the appointment of an Indian agent at Detroit.
